Compare all specifications:

1960 Fairthorpe Electrina 1961 Simca 1000
Make Fairthorpe Simca
Model Electrina 1000
Year Released 1960 1961
Engine Position Front Rear
Engine Size 948 cc 944 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 49 HP 51 HP
Engine RPM 6000 RPM 5300 RPM
Torque 69 Nm 73 Nm
Number of Seats 5 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 2 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Weight 450 kg 730 kg
Vehicle Length 3740 mm 3930 mm
Vehicle Width 1530 mm 1530 mm
Vehicle Height 1330 mm 1260 mm
Wheelbase Size 2090 mm 2230 mm
